Transaction 04bbd74dc8f686e9026641176c483409797f8d9620436918d898e37a33bb19d7
1 Input
1 Output
-
04bbd74dc8f686e9026641176c483409797f8d9620436918d898e37a33bb19d7:0
- value
- 77532
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 889ed8d1e17bfc5d4a10649fa528a9b81770e628 OP_EQUAL
- address
- 3E9Q7Wg7EJ4AgggyTd3JLT6XCgthQSepkB